3.3 Data Formats

3.3.1 Dates

  1. Specified in this data spec as DATE.
  2. All dates must be formatted DDMMCCYY eg, 31031943.

3.3.2 Integers

  1. Specified in this data specification as INT.
  2. These are integer numbers.
  3. There should be no decimal points or commas included.
  4. All values should be expressed as positives.

3.3.3 Numbers

  1. Specified in this data specification as NO.
  2. These are numbers including decimal places.
  3. The number of decimal places will be indicated where a Number field is specified.
  4. There should be no decimal points or commas included.
  5. Values submitted need to be left padded so values are submitted with the correct number of decimals.
  6. All values should be expressed as positives.

3.3.4 Currency Values

  1. Specified in this data specification as $.
  2. All currency values should be expressed as cents unless otherwise stated.
  3. There should be no decimal points or commas included.
  4. All values should be inclusive of Goods and Services Tax (GST) unless otherwise stated.

3.3.5 Character Values

  1. Specified in this data specification as CHAR.
  2. Character fields should be surrounded be text quotes “Example”.
  3. Character fields must not contain any commas.
